tgoop.com/Computer_IT_Engineering/33263
Last Update:
🏷 دوره جامع آموزش Less
📝 زبان: فارسی
🎥 تعداد ویدئوها: 6 ویدئو
⏱ مدت: حدود 1 ساعت و 32 دقیقه
💽 کیفیت: بسیار خوب
📊 سطح آموزش: متوسط
👤 مدرس: سید علیرضا سیواریز
🌀سورس: ندارد
🔗 منبع: دانشجویار
💡 اگر بدانید که با استفاده از یک ابزار کاربردی میتوانید از نوشتن حجم زیادی از CSS های تکراری خلاص شوید چه احساسی خواهید داشت؟ در ابتدای یادگیری طراحی وب، شاید نوشتن کدهای CSS برای شما سرگرم کننده باشد و از نوشتن آنها لذت ببرید؛ اما هرچه جلوتر میروید و پروژههای بزرگتر انجام میدهید نوشتن کدهای CSS به شدت خسته کننده میشود و از آنجا که کدهای CSS ایستا هستند، مجبور میشوید بارها و بارها کدهای CSS ثابتی را تکرار کرده و به عنوان مثال یک کد پس زمینه را بارها و در جاهای مختلف در برنامه خود استفاده کنید. در نهایت یک فایل بسیار بزرگ CSS و بسیار شلوغ خواهید داشت که اگر بخواهید در قسمتی از آن ویرایشی انجام بدهید، با مشکل مواجه خواهید شد.
🔆 به همین دلیل برای سادهسازی کار و همچنین صرفهجویی در وقت ابزاری به وجود آمده که از آن با عنوان پیش پردازنده LESS یاد میشود. شاید یادگیری و آموزش LESS از ملزومات برنامهنویسی وب نباشد، اما میتواند وجه تمایز بین یک برنامهنویس حرفهای و برنامهنویس معمولی باشد. هدف ما نیز در این دورهی آموزش LESS درواقع ایجاد همین تفاوت است. در این دوره آموزش فریمورک LESS یاد خواهید گرفت که چگونه کدهای CSS تمیزتر و بهینهتری داشته باشید.
💢 منظور از پیش پردازنده CSS چیست؟
🔆 پیش پردازنده های CSS زبان های اسکریپتی هستند که قابلیت های پیش فرض CSS را گسترش می دهند. آنها ما را قادر می سازند تا از منطق در کد CSS خود، مانند متغیر، کدهای تودرتو ، وراثت، مخلوط، توابع و عملیات ریاضی استفاده کنیم. پیش پردازنده CSS خودکار کردن کارهای تکراری را بسیار آسان میکند و همچنین تعداد خطاها را کاهش میدهد.
💢 مزایای یادگیری LESS برای طراحی سایت:
🔆 تکرار مکرر کدهای ثابت CSS در طراحی سایت کلافه کننده است و هر برنامهنویس علاقمندی را نیز خسته میکند. فریمورک Less این مشکل را برای برنامهنویسان حل کرده و کاری میکند که نوشتن CSS همچنان سرگرم کننده بماند. این ابزار به شما این امکان را میدهد که استایل بخشهای مختلف پروژه را در فایلهای جداگانه قرار داده و بتوانید مدیریت بهتری را بر روی آنها داشته باشید. از طرفی به کمک Less میتوانید در کدهای CSS خود مانند یک زبان برنامهنویسی، متغیر داشته باشید، تابع داشته باشید، محاسبات انجام دهید و … که این امکانات باعث میشود سرعت استایلدهی شما چند برابر شود و مخصوصا در پروژههای بزرگ، کدهای بسیار بهینهتری داشته باشید.
💢 اگر بخواهیم مزایای Less را به صورت کلی مرور کنیم شامل موارد زیر میشود:
◉ امکان استفاده از برنامهنویسی در استایلدهی
◉ افزایش سرعت در کدنویسی
◉ بهینه سازی فایل CSS
◉ خوانایی بهتر دستورات
💢 چرا یادگیری LESS اهمیت دارد؟
به چند دلیل مشاهده آموزش LESS بر هر برنامهنویس وبی واجب و حیاتی است.
◉ به کمک قریمورک LESS، CSS مناسبتر، سریعتر و همچنین سازگارتری در مرورگرهای مختلف خواهید داشت.
◉ LESS در JavaScript طوری طراحی شده که به صورت زنده قابل استفاده باشد و سریعتر از سایر پیشپردازندههای CSS کامپایل شود.
◉ LESS کد شما را به روشی مدولار نگهداری میکند. همین موضوع باعث شده که خواندن و تغییر دادن آن به سرعت قابل انجام باشد.
💢 بازار کار دوره آموزش LESS:
شما بعد از گذراندن این دوره و کسب مهارت میتوانید در یک شرکت طراحی وب کار کنید یا میتوانید به عنوان فریلنسر پروژههای طراحی وب دریافت کنید. همچنین میتوانید به عنوان طراح وب به طور مستقل کار کنید و شرکت طراحی وب خودتان را راه اندازی کنید.
✅ حاصل دوره
در واقع شما با گذراندن این دوره ، فوت کوزه گری را یاد خواهید گرفت و مطمئنا می توانید قالبی را طراحی کنید که مشتری را در جای خود میخکوب کند، چرا که شما مهارت خود را در طراحی یک قالب به یاد ماندنی، در ذهن ها ثبت میکنید.
⬅️ پیشنیاز
اگر چه در این دوره به صورت جامع و کامل به تمامی مباحث آموزش LESS پرداخته شده با این حال، برای یادگیری Less شما ابتدا باید بر مفاهیم CSS مسلط باشید.
👥 مخاطبین دوره
این دوره رایگان برای دانشجویان و همچنین افراد حرفهای که میخواهند وبسایت ها یا وبلاگهای شخصی خود یا دیگران را جذابتر کنند، بسیار کاربردی خواهد بود.
🛠 ابزار مورد نیاز
◉ VsCode
🔰 سر فصل دوره :
📌 جلسه 1- نصب Less
📌 جلسه 2- متغیرها
📌 جلسه 3- Mixin
📌 جلسه 4- Nesting
📌 جلسه 5- Operation escaping Functions
📌 جلسه 6- Maps Scope Import
#فیلم #ویدئو #وب #جاوااسکریپت
#Video #Web #JavaScript #Css #Less
🆑 @Computer_IT_Engineering
BY Computer & IT Engineering
Share with your friend now:
tgoop.com/Computer_IT_Engineering/33263